Description

Magnetometer survey south of Junction 3 of the A14 at Rothwell, Northamptonshire. Although heavy growth denied access to the entire scheme, prospection revealed part of a relict medieval farming landscape over an area of approximately 5.6ha within three fields. Two ridge and furrow cultivation schemes were defined at approximately right-angles between Field 1 and the other two fields. Fields 1 and 2 are currently separated by a drain. The drain is believed to divert water into the Slade Brook from a possible former stream identified between the two fields. A possible ditch of unknown purpose was identified in Field 1.
